Hitec Servos

http://www.hobby-lobby.com/yak54suitcase.htm
I am planning to buy the above aeroplane! It has the extra things that it needs to fly . It gives HTS055 Hitec HS-55 Sub Micro Servos . Do you know if they are compatible with futaba receivers?

Re: Hitec Servos

Yes, they're compatible. You can pretty much use any servo with any receiver.

Re: Hitec Servos

I just got that plane in yesterday. Nice kit, make sure that you go over the covering around the edges of the cut outs with an iron to make sure they are sealed. It took me about 2 hours to fully assemble and install all gear. I was taking my time and doing some computer work during the assembly.

As for the HS 55 servos. I have never had a problem with then working with any receiver I have used. I have used Hi-tec, Futaba, GWS, Spektrum, Berg, and Great Planes receivers with no issues.

I haven't had a chance to fly it yet, but my Hacker A20-22L will hold it at hover just under 1/2 throttle. I have an all up weight of 16.5 oz.
